Real estate brokers who charge a one time fee (or flat fee) for only those services actually purchased by the consumer are referred to as fee-for-service (or limited service) brokers. State mandated “minimum service” laws dictate to what extent the full service can be stripped into individual components. Consumers who choose this option can realize savings of up to thousands of dollars. Also see “flat fee mls“.

Texas Flat Fee MLS Broker Services
Negative icon Limits choice of brokerage services
Positive icon Allows brokers to offer rebates to consumers


Texas
law requires real estate brokers to accept and present offers and counteroffers and answer their clients’ questions in every real estate transaction, even if consumers do not wish to buy these services.
